What you’ll be doing:

You will support the implementation of project controls processes across large, high-value projects, ensuring the consistent application of best-practice methodologies throughout the project lifecycle. You will monitor and report on project performance by analysing cost, schedule, and key performance indicators from multiple data sources, providing clear insights to support effective decision-making. You will work closely with Project Managers and Control Account Managers, offering data-driven support to manage cost, schedule, risks, and emerging issues. You will also maintain core project controls activities, including Estimate at Completion (EAC) updates, resource profiling, and supporting risk and opportunity management to help ensure successful project delivery

Core duties:

  • You will bring extensive professional experience in project coordinates, with the capability to support large and multi-layered projects.
  • You will demonstrate experienced knowledge of core Project Controls disciplines, including reporting, Earned Value Management (EVM), cost management, scheduling, risk and opportunity guidance, and baseline change control.
  • You will be proficient in key Project Controls toolsets such as COBRA and Tableau.
  • You will apply good assessing and problem-solving skills to interpret highly detailed data from multiple sources, conduct root cause analysis, and present clear, actionable recommendations to senior stakeholders.

The Project Controls Team:

You will join the Project Controls team supporting the Type 26 Programme delivering eight advanced naval vessels across the UK. Working with the Control Account Manager and Project Manager, you’ll provide project controls insight, collaborate with stakeholders, and develop your career within BAE Systems programme.

Please be aware that many roles at BAE Systems are subject to both security and export control restrictions. These restrictions mean that factors such as your nationality, any nationalities you may have previously held, and your place of birth can restrict the roles you are eligible to perform within the organisation. All applicants must as a minimum achieve Baseline Personnel Security Standard. Many roles also require higher levels of National Security Vetting where applicants must typically have 5 to 10 years of continuous residency in the UK depending on the vetting level required for the role, to allow for meaningful security vetting checks.
